Through a combination of lectures, workshops, and real-world case studies, you’ll gain expertise in:
- The Role of Audit in the Financial System: Understand the critical function of audits in maintaining the integrity and reliability of financial reporting.
- The Audit Process: Master the key stages of an audit, from planning and risk assessment to testing internal controls, substantive procedures, and reporting.
- Internal Controls: Develop the ability to evaluate the effectiveness of an organization’s internal control framework in mitigating financial risks.
- Audit Evidence: Grasp the different types of audit evidence needed to support audit conclusions and ensure the reliability of financial statements.
- Audit Reporting: Learn how to prepare clear, concise, and informative audit reports that communicate findings and recommendations to stakeholders.
